以黃酮結構探討藍花楹抗氧化活性

A Study of the Structural Analysis on Antioxidant Properties of Flavonoids Extracted from Jacaranda Acutifolia

摘要


為探討藍花楹萃取物作為抗氧化化妝品的可行性,本研究先以藍花楹花部丙酮萃取物進行抗氧化活性評估,經實驗結果顯示其萃取物乙酸乙酯層具有最明顯的清除DPPH自由基與螯合亞鐵的能力。本研究續將上述乙酸乙酯層與正丁醇層進行活性導向成分分離與鑑定,獲得五種黃酮化合物,進一步比較黃酮化合物之結構與抗氧化活性間的關係。實驗結果顯示此五種黃酮化合物清除DPPH自由基IC_(50)值範圍介於0.18至0.82mg/mL之間。

To evaluate the feasibility of using Jacaranda acutifolia extract as an antioxidant ingredient for cosmetics, a series of antioxidant activity assays were performed on the acetone extracts from its flower. The results indicated that the ethyl acetate soluble fraction (JAFE) of Jacaranda acutifolia flower extracts exhibited the highest DPPH radical scavenging and ferric ion reducing activities. The ethyl acetate soluble fraction (JAFE) and butyl alcohol soluble fraction (JAFB) of the extracts were further separated for constituent identification, and five flavonoid compounds were obtained. The structural related antioxidant properties of above flavonoid compounds were examined. Test results revealed that IC_(50) values of DPPH free radical scavenging capability for these five compounds were ranged from 0.18 to 0.82 mg/mL.
